The global inkjet market is projected to exceed USD 130 billion in 2026, and the growth is not coming from marketing hype -- it is coming from hardware. Printheads, inks, and inline systems are being redesigned around three goals: higher speed, lower cost per impression, and quality that finally closes the gap with offset. For print buyers, the consequence is that digital is no longer the compromise option.
Printheads That Adapt
The 2026 wave of printhead designs leans on MEMS microfabrication -- precision nozzles etched with semiconductor techniques -- delivering more uniform droplets at higher firing frequencies and extended lifetimes. The more interesting shift is adaptive nozzle arrays: individual nozzles can be reconfigured dynamically, so a clogged jet does not stop a run or produce a visible band. Downtime that used to cost hours now costs seconds.
Ink Chemistry Catches Up With Substrates
Ink is where the quality leap happens. New UV-curing formulations offer stronger adhesion to challenging surfaces plus improved abrasion and water resistance, which matters for labels and packaging that ship through rough logistics. Meanwhile, food-safe water-based inks are moving into packaging that touches consumables, replacing UV and solvent systems that regulators increasingly dislike. The result: digital prints that survive handling tests they failed five years ago.
Coding at Production Speed
The industrial side of inkjet is accelerating too. LEIBINGER's 2D-JET, shown at interpack 2026, prints QR codes and data matrix codes at up to 120 meters per minute at 300 DPI, inline with existing packaging lines. When variable codes can be applied at full line speed, the economics of serialized packaging -- traceability, anti-counterfeit, personalized offers -- finally make sense for mass-market products.
What This Means for Books and Boxes
For book printing, the threshold that matters is quality: high-speed digital inkjet now produces text and halftones close to conventional offset, with none of the makeready cost. For packaging, hybrid systems combining digital printing with inline finishing -- lamination, die-cutting -- turn a single pass into a finished product. The practical takeaway: minimum order quantities keep falling while quality expectations keep rising.
